图像检索评价指标

作者:demo2024.02.17 14:29浏览量:5

简介:图像检索是一种利用计算机技术从图像库中检索出与查询图像相似的图像的方法。为了评估检索结果的质量,需要使用一系列的评价指标。本文将介绍常见的图像检索评价指标,包括查准率、查全率、F-Score和平均检索精度等。

图像检索是一种利用计算机技术从图像库中检索出与查询图像相似的图像的方法。为了评估检索结果的质量,需要使用一系列的评价指标。本文将介绍常见的图像检索评价指标,包括查准率、查全率、F-Score和平均检索精度等。

一、查准率(Precision)
查准率是指所有预测为正的样本中,真实正样本所占的比例。在图像检索中,查准率表示检索出的相似图像中真正相似的比例。计算查准率的方法如下:

  1. 选取一个合适的阈值,将图像库中的图像与查询图像进行比较,判断是否相似。
  2. 统计预测为正的样本中,真正相似的样本数。
  3. 计算查准率,即真正相似的样本数除以预测为正的样本数。

二、查全率(Recall)
查全率是指所有的正样本中,预测为正的样本的比例。在图像检索中,查全率表示所有相似的图像中被检索出来的比例。计算查全率的方法如下:

  1. 统计图像库中与查询图像真正相似的样本数。
  2. 选取一个合适的阈值,将图像库中的图像与查询图像进行比较,判断是否相似。
  3. 计算查全率,即被检索出来的真正相似的样本数除以所有相似的样本数。

三、F-Score
F-Score是一种综合评价指标,它对查准率和查全率都有较高的要求。F-Score的计算方法如下:

  1. 计算查准率和查全率的加权平均值,其中权重的取值可以根据实际需求进行调整。
  2. 将加权平均值归一化,得到F-Score的值。

四、平均检索精度(Average Precision, AP)
平均检索精度是一种常用的评价指标,用于评估检索结果的准确性。计算平均检索精度的方法如下:

  1. 将图像库中的图像按照与查询图像的相似度进行排序。
  2. 选取一个合适的阈值,将排序后的图像分为正样本和负样本。
  3. 对于每一个正样本,计算其前后的负样本数量之和与该正样本的位置的比值,得到该正样本的精度。
  4. 将所有正样本的精度取平均值,得到平均检索精度。

在实际应用中,可以根据具体需求选择合适的评价指标来评估图像检索的结果。同时,还需要注意以下几点:

  1. 选择合适的阈值进行比较时,需要根据实际情况进行调整,以保证评价指标的准确性。
  2. 在计算平均检索精度时,需要考虑负样本的数量和位置对结果的影响,合理选取阈值进行分类。
  3. 在评估检索结果时,需要考虑不同评价指标之间的平衡,以全面评价检索结果的质量。